	Normally the FIT timestamp is created the first time mkimage is run on a FIT, when converting the source .its to the binary .fit file. This corresponds to using the -f flag. But if the original input to mkimage is a binary file (already compiled) then the timestamp is assumed to have been set previously. Add a -t flag to allow setting the timestamp in this case. | .SH "DESCRIPTION"
 | |
| The
 | |
| .B mkimage
 | |
| command is used to create images for use with the U-Boot boot loader.
 | |
| These images can contain the linux kernel, device tree blob, root file
 | |
| system image, firmware images etc., either separate or combined.
 | |
| 
 | |
| .B mkimage
 | |
| supports two different formats:
 | |
| 
 | |
| The old
 | |
| .I legacy image
 | |
| format concatenates the individual parts (for example, kernel image,
 | |
| device tree blob and ramdisk image) and adds a 64 bytes header
 | |
| containing information about target architecture, operating system,
 | |
| image type, compression method, entry points, time stamp, checksums,
 | |
| etc.
 | |
| 
 | |
| The new
 | |
| .I FIT (Flattened Image Tree) format
 | |
| allows for more flexibility in handling images of various types and also
 | |
| enhances integrity protection of images with stronger checksums. It also
 | |
| supports verified boot.

| .SH "OPTIONS"
 | |
| 
 | |
| .B List image information:
 | |
| 
 | |
| .TP
 | |
| .BI "\-l [" "uimage file name" "]"
 | |
| mkimage lists the information contained in the header of an existing U-Boot image.
 | |
| 
 | |
| .P
 | |
| .B Create old legacy image:
 | |
| 
 | |
| .TP
 | |
| .BI "\-A [" "architecture" "]"
 | |
| Set architecture. Pass \-h as the architecture to see the list of supported architectures.
 | |
| 
 | |
| .TP
 | |
| .BI "\-O [" "os" "]"
 | |
| Set operating system. bootm command of u-boot changes boot method by os type.
 | |
| Pass \-h as the OS to see the list of supported OS.
 | |
| 
 | |
| .TP
 | |
| .BI "\-T [" "image type" "]"
 | |
| Set image type.
 | |
| Pass \-h as the image to see the list of supported image type.
 | |
| 
 | |
| .TP
 | |
| .BI "\-C [" "compression type" "]"
 | |
| Set compression type.
 | |
| Pass \-h as the compression to see the list of supported compression type.
 | |
| 
 | |
| .TP
 | |
| .BI "\-a [" "load address" "]"
 | |
| Set load address with a hex number.
 | |
| 
 | |
| .TP
 | |
| .BI "\-e [" "entry point" "]"
 | |
| Set entry point with a hex number.
 | |
| 
 | |
| .TP
 | |
| .BI "\-l"
 | |
| List the contents of an image.
 | |
| 
 | |
| .TP
 | |
| .BI "\-n [" "image name" "]"
 | |
| Set image name to 'image name'.
 | |
| 
 | |
| .TP
 | |
| .BI "\-d [" "image data file" "]"
 | |
| Use image data from 'image data file'.
 | |
| 
 | |
| .TP
 | |
| .BI "\-x"
 | |
| Set XIP (execute in place) flag.
 | |
| 
 | |
| .P
 | |
| .B Create FIT image:
 | |
| 
 | |
| .TP
 | |
| .BI "\-b [" "device tree file" "]
 | |
| Appends the device tree binary file (.dtb) to the FIT.
 | |
| 
 | |
| .TP
 | |
| .BI "\-c [" "comment" "]"
 | |
| Specifies a comment to be added when signing. This is typically a useful
 | |
| message which describes how the image was signed or some other useful
 | |
| information.
 | |
| 
 | |
| .TP
 | |
| .BI "\-D [" "dtc options" "]"
 | |
| Provide special options to the device tree compiler that is used to
 | |
| create the image.
 | |
| 
 | |
| .TP
 | |
| .BI "\-E
 | |
| After processing, move the image data outside the FIT and store a data offset
 | |
| in the FIT. Images will be placed one after the other immediately after the
 | |
| FIT, with each one aligned to a 4-byte boundary. The existing 'data' property
 | |
| in each image will be replaced with 'data-offset' and 'data-size' properties.
 | |
| A 'data-offset' of 0 indicates that it starts in the first (4-byte aligned)
 | |
| byte after the FIT.
 | |
| 
 | |
| .TP
 | |
| .BI "\-f [" "image tree source file" " | " "auto" "]"
 | |
| Image tree source file that describes the structure and contents of the
 | |
| FIT image.
 | |
| 
 | |
| This can be automatically generated for some simple cases.
 | |
| Use "-f auto" for this. In that case the arguments -d, -A, -O, -T, -C, -a
 | |
| and -e are used to specify the image to include in the FIT and its attributes.
 | |
| No .its file is required.
 | |
| 
 | |
| .TP
 | |
| .BI "\-F"
 | |
| Indicates that an existing FIT image should be modified. No dtc
 | |
| compilation is performed and the \-f flag should not be given.
 | |
| This can be used to sign images with additional keys after initial image
 | |
| creation.
 | |
| 
 | |
| .TP
 | |
| .BI "\-i [" "ramdisk_file" "]"
 | |
| Appends the ramdisk file to the FIT.
 | |
| 
 | |
| .TP
 | |
| .BI "\-k [" "key_directory" "]"
 | |
| Specifies the directory containing keys to use for signing. This directory
 | |
| should contain a private key file <name>.key for use with signing and a
 | |
| certificate <name>.crt (containing the public key) for use with verification.
 | |
| 
 | |
| .TP
 | |
| .BI "\-K [" "key_destination" "]"
 | |
| Specifies a compiled device tree binary file (typically .dtb) to write
 | |
| public key information into. When a private key is used to sign an image,
 | |
| the corresponding public key is written into this file for for run-time
 | |
| verification. Typically the file here is the device tree binary used by
 | |
| CONFIG_OF_CONTROL in U-Boot.
 | |
| 
 | |
| .TP
 | |
| .BI "\-p [" "external position" "]"
 | |
| Place external data at a static external position. See \-E. Instead of writing
 | |
| a 'data-offset' property defining the offset from the end of the FIT, \-p will
 | |
| use 'data-position' as the absolute position from the base of the FIT.
 | |
| 
 | |
| .TP
 | |
| .BI "\-r
 | |
| Specifies that keys used to sign the FIT are required. This means that they
 | |
| must be verified for the image to boot. Without this option, the verification
 | |
| will be optional (useful for testing but not for release).
 | |
| 
 | |
| .TP
 | |
| .BI "\-t
 | |
| Update the timestamp in the FIT.
 | |
| 
 | |
| Normally the FIT timestamp is created the first time mkimage is run on a FIT,
 | |
| when converting the source .its to the binary .fit file. This corresponds to
 | |
| using the -f flag. But if the original input to mkimage is a binary file
 | |
| (already compiled) then the timestamp is assumed to have been set previously.

| .SH EXAMPLES
 | |
| 
 | |
| List image information:
 | |
| .nf
 | |
| .B mkimage -l uImage
 | |
| .fi
 | |
| .P
 | |
| Create legacy image with compressed PowerPC Linux kernel:
 | |
| .nf
 | |
| .B mkimage -A powerpc -O linux -T kernel -C gzip \\\\
 | |
| .br
 | |
| .B -a 0 -e 0 -n Linux -d vmlinux.gz uImage
 | |
| .fi
 | |
| .P
 | |
| Create FIT image with compressed PowerPC Linux kernel:
 | |
| .nf
 | |
| .B mkimage -f kernel.its kernel.itb
 | |
| .fi
 | |
| .P
 | |
| Create FIT image with compressed kernel and sign it with keys in the
 | |
| /public/signing-keys directory. Add corresponding public keys into u-boot.dtb,
 | |
| skipping those for which keys cannot be found. Also add a comment.
 | |
| .nf
 | |
| .B mkimage -f kernel.its -k /public/signing-keys -K u-boot.dtb \\\\
 | |
| .br
 | |
| .B -c """Kernel 3.8 image for production devices""" kernel.itb
 | |
| .fi
 | |
| 
 | |
| .P
 | |
| Update an existing FIT image, signing it with additional keys.
 | |
| Add corresponding public keys into u-boot.dtb. This will resign all images
 | |
| with keys that are available in the new directory. Images that request signing
 | |
| with unavailable keys are skipped.
 | |
| .nf
 | |
| .B mkimage -F -k /secret/signing-keys -K u-boot.dtb \\\\
 | |
| .br
 | |
| .B -c """Kernel 3.8 image for production devices""" kernel.itb
 | |
| .fi
 | |
| 
 | |
| .P
 | |
| Create a FIT image containing a kernel, using automatic mode. No .its file
 | |
| is required.
 | |
| .nf
 | |
| .B mkimage -f auto -A arm -O linux -T kernel -C none -a 43e00000 -e 0 \\\\
 | |
| .br
 | |
| .B -c """Kernel 4.4 image for production devices""" -d vmlinuz kernel.itb
 | |
| .fi
 | |
| .P
 | |
| Create a FIT image containing a kernel and some device tree files, using
 | |
| automatic mode. No .its file is required.
 | |
| .nf
 | |
| .B mkimage -f auto -A arm -O linux -T kernel -C none -a 43e00000 -e 0 \\\\
 | |
| .br
 | |
| .B -c """Kernel 4.4 image for production devices""" -d vmlinuz \\\\
 | |
| .B -b /path/to/rk3288-firefly.dtb -b /path/to/rk3288-jerry.dtb kernel.itb
 | |
| .fi
